UK Drill Artist Kgrindz Gains Momentum in the U.S. as International Interest Grows

British drill rapper Kgrindz is building a noticeable foothold with hip hop listeners in the United States, and the growth feels tied to steady engagement rather than a single breakout moment. His recent single “What’s Goody” featuring Kwengface has helped introduce him to new ears, but the wider attention around his name has continued to move on its own path.
Over the past few months, U.S.-based listeners have been tapping into Kgrindz’s catalog with real consistency. What stands out is how firmly he stays rooted in UK drill while still connecting across borders. The music does not come off watered down or reshaped for a different audience. Instead, it translates naturally, driven by delivery, presence, and an approach that stays focused on craft.
A major signal of that momentum has been the uptick in American YouTube creators covering his work. Reaction videos from U.S. listeners have become more common, bringing Kgrindz into new corners of the platform and helping widen his visibility. These clips often highlight his cadence and calm control, pointing to a style that lands even when the cultural context is unfamiliar.
The conversation around Kgrindz has also shifted. Rather than centering on one track at a time, fans are increasingly discussing his overall output and identity. Listeners mention consistency, replay value, and the cohesion across releases, treating him less like a passing discovery and more like a name that belongs in the broader drill discussion.
His rise also fits a larger pattern: U.S. audiences are paying closer attention to international rap scenes, especially artists who keep their identity intact while finding new territory. In Kgrindz’s case, the growth appears tied to shared clips, ongoing commentary, and repeat listening, not a quick viral spike.
With reaction content spreading, fan discussions staying active, and cross-platform engagement continuing to build, Kgrindz looks positioned as more than a moment. The trajectory suggests an artist whose reach is expanding in a way that feels earned, with international buzz that keeps gaining ground as the music circulates.
